A merchant cash advance is a type of funding where you receive a lump sum now and repay it through a percentage of your future credit card sales or daily bank deposits. It is not a loan in the traditional sense, and it can be a flexible option for businesses that need working capital quickly.

Small business funding options in Clovis

Clovis businesses have several funding paths to consider, and the right one depends on your goals and cash flow. A merchant cash advance can work well for businesses with steady card sales, like restaurants or retail shops. Working capital funding can help cover day-to-day expenses, while equipment financing lets you buy or lease machinery, vehicles, or technology without draining your reserves. Business lines of credit give you flexible access to funds when you need them, and invoice or receivables funding turns unpaid invoices into cash you can use now.

Because Clovis sits in Fresno County, many local businesses face seasonal swings tied to agriculture, tourism, and the broader Valley economy. Having options that fit your revenue pattern matters. Frequently asked questions

What is a merchant cash advance?

A merchant cash advance is not a loan. It is a lump sum of money provided to a business in exchange for a portion of future credit card sales or daily bank deposits. Repayment is typically automatic and adjusts with your sales volume, which can be helpful when business is slower.

Does applying affect my credit?

Many funding partners perform a soft credit check that does not impact your credit score, but some may do a hard inquiry. We recommend asking each partner about their credit check process before you proceed. Our matching service itself does not check your credit.

Do I qualify for small business funding in Clovis?

Qualification depends on the funding partner and your business profile. Factors like time in business, monthly revenue, and credit history often play a role, but every partner has different criteria. There are no guarantees, but many small businesses with steady revenue can find options.
